2024 Cuban protests. On 17 March 2024, protests began in Cuba, [2] primarily in the city of Santiago de Cuba, the country's second largest city, in protest of food shortages and power outages in particular. [3] [4] The country experienced what was described as the worst living crisis since the early 1990s. [5]

The Women's March on Washington was a January 21, 2017, protest in Washington, D.C., which attracted about 597,000 people to Independence Ave & Third St. to protest Donald Trump's first full day in office. Simultaneous protests drew large crowds across all 50 US states, and on six continents.
